If fact, it'll make it harder to do the end play procedure with more weight on the e-shaft. The only thing that matters is that the "front stack" is complete and torqued down to spec. This includes everything under the front oil cover + front pulley boss + front eccentric shaft bolt torqued to spec. -Ted |
